(C) Access to Personal Data
As provided for in the PDPO, you have a right to
- request access to your Personal Data, including the right to obtain a copy of your Personal Data provided in the application form subject to payment of a fee.
- require correction of your Personal Data which is inaccurate; and
- ascertain our policies and practices regarding Personal Date and to be informed about the types of Personal Data we hold.
In accordance with the PDPO, we have the right to charge a reasonable fee for the processing of any data access request. Any such request, including making of access and corrections, must be made in accordance with the terms of the PDPO and should be addressed to contact@bfcapital.com.
